In today’s digital world, many users prefer desktop applications over browser tabs. Desktop apps offer better focus, easier access, and a more seamless user experience. This is where Nativefier becomes a valuable tool. It allows users and developers to convert almost any web application into a native desktop application with minimal effort.
One of the most common questions asked by users is: Which platforms does Nativefier support? Understanding platform compatibility is essential before using Nativefier for personal projects, business tools, or productivity applications.
Read More: How Do I Install Nativefier?
What Is Nativefier?
Nativefier is an open-source command-line tool that transforms web applications into desktop applications using Electron. Instead of building a desktop app from scratch, Nativefier wraps an existing website or web application inside an Electron container, creating a standalone desktop experience.
Popular services such as Gmail, WhatsApp Web, Trello, Slack, Notion, and many others can be converted into desktop apps using Nativefier.
The tool is widely appreciated because it requires minimal coding knowledge and enables users to create custom desktop applications quickly.
Understanding Nativefier Platform Support
When discussing platform support, there are two important aspects to consider:
- Platforms where Nativefier can be installed and used.
- Platforms for which Nativefier can generate desktop applications.
Fortunately, Nativefier supports all major desktop operating systems, making it a flexible solution for developers and everyday users alike.
Nativefier Support for Windows
Windows is one of the most widely used operating systems globally, and Nativefier fully supports it.
Users can install Nativefier on Windows systems using Node.js and npm. Once installed, they can generate standalone desktop applications for Windows-based environments.
Key Benefits for Windows Users
Windows users can enjoy several advantages when using Nativefier:
- Easy installation through npm.
- Compatibility with modern Windows versions.
- Creation of portable desktop applications.
- Support for custom icons and application settings.
- Ability to package web apps into executable files.
Many organizations use Nativefier to create dedicated desktop versions of internal web tools, helping employees access critical applications without opening browsers repeatedly.
Nativefier Support for macOS
Nativefier also provides excellent support for macOS. Apple users can convert websites into native-looking desktop applications that integrate smoothly with the macOS environment.
Whether you’re using a MacBook, iMac, or Mac Studio, Nativefier can help create standalone applications for productivity, communication, and workflow management.
Advantages for macOS Users
macOS users benefit from:
- Native desktop application experience.
- Dock integration.
- Custom application icons.
- Dedicated application windows.
- Simplified access to frequently used web services.
This makes Nativefier particularly useful for users who rely heavily on cloud-based tools but prefer a desktop-oriented workflow.
Nativefier Support for Linux
Linux users are among the strongest supporters of open-source tools, making Nativefier a natural fit within the Linux ecosystem.
Nativefier works well across many Linux distributions, including:
- Ubuntu
- Debian
- Fedora
- Arch Linux
- Linux Mint
- OpenSUSE
Because Linux users often customize their environments extensively, Nativefier provides a convenient way to transform web applications into desktop programs that integrate with their preferred desktop environments.
Why Linux Users Like Nativefier
There are several reasons Linux users appreciate Nativefier:
- Open-source compatibility.
- Lightweight deployment options.
- Support for multiple distributions.
- Easy integration into development workflows.
- Ability to package cloud services as desktop applications.
This flexibility makes Nativefier a valuable tool for both personal and professional Linux users.
Cross-Platform Application Generation
One of Nativefier’s most attractive features is its cross-platform capabilities.
In many cases, developers can create application packages for different operating systems without manually rebuilding entire applications from scratch.
Supported target platforms generally include:
- Windows
- macOS
- Linux
This broad compatibility allows teams to distribute applications to users across different operating systems while maintaining a consistent user experience.
However, developers should always verify current Electron and Nativefier documentation because cross-compilation capabilities can vary depending on system configuration and package requirements.
Does Nativefier Support Mobile Platforms?
A common misconception is that Nativefier can create mobile applications.
Nativefier is specifically designed for desktop environments and does not provide native support for:
- Android
- iOS
- iPadOS
Its architecture is based on Electron, which focuses primarily on desktop application development.
If your goal is to convert a web application into a mobile app, alternative frameworks such as React Native, Flutter, Capacitor, or Ionic may be more suitable.
Browser Compatibility and Web App Support
Since Nativefier converts websites into desktop applications, platform support also depends on the web application being wrapped.
Most modern websites work well because Nativefier uses Chromium through Electron.
This means users can generally convert:
- Productivity platforms
- Project management tools
- Messaging applications
- Online dashboards
- Learning platforms
- Business portals
- Social media web interfaces
As long as a website functions correctly in Chromium-based browsers, there is a strong chance it will work effectively within a Nativefier-generated application.
Requirements for Using Nativefier
Before creating desktop applications, users should ensure they have the necessary requirements installed.
These typically include:
Node.js
Nativefier is distributed through npm, making Node.js an essential requirement.
npm Package Manager
npm allows users to install Nativefier and manage updates efficiently.
Internet Connection
An internet connection is required for downloading packages and accessing the web applications being converted.
Sufficient Storage
Electron-based applications can be larger than traditional software because they include Chromium components.
Ensuring adequate storage space helps avoid installation and packaging issues.
Benefits of Nativefier Across Supported Platforms
Regardless of whether you use Windows, macOS, or Linux, Nativefier offers several advantages:
Improved Productivity
Dedicated desktop apps reduce browser tab clutter and help users stay focused.
Faster Access
Applications can be launched directly from the desktop, taskbar, dock, or application menu.
Better Organization
Users can separate work tools from personal browsing activities.
Custom Branding
Businesses can create branded desktop versions of internal web applications.
Enhanced User Experience
Native desktop windows often provide a more professional and streamlined experience than keeping services open in browser tabs.
Conclusion
Nativefier supports the three major desktop operating systems: Windows, macOS, and Linux. This broad compatibility makes it an excellent solution for users and developers who want to transform web applications into standalone desktop programs.
Whether you’re using Windows for business tasks, macOS for creative workflows, or Linux for development projects, Nativefier offers a simple and effective way to bring web applications to the desktop. While it does not support mobile platforms like Android or iOS, its strong desktop compatibility and ease of use continue to make it one of the most popular tools for web-to-desktop application conversion.
For anyone seeking a quick and efficient method to create desktop applications from existing websites, Nativefier remains a powerful cross-platform solution.
